Risks, trade-offs, and common misunderstandings
The biggest beginner mistake is assuming that a polished website equals frictionless service. It does not. A clean design can make a site easy to navigate, but it cannot eliminate verification, responsible gaming checks, or payment review. Plaza Royal’s platform background suggests a stable service environment, yet every casino still has trade-offs.
Common misunderstandings include:
- “Support can fix anything instantly.” Not true. Some issues require compliance review or third-party payment processing.
- “All Canadian players have the same experience.” Not true. Province, payment method, and account history all affect outcomes.
- “A bonus is free money.” Not true. Bonuses usually involve wagering rules and game limits.
- “Mobile play means there is an app.” Not necessarily. Plaza Royal is described as mobile-optimized rather than app-based.
Another trade-off is that platform casinos can be efficient but not highly personalized. That is useful if you want predictability, yet less ideal if you expect bespoke service. A beginner should view this as a stability-versus-flexibility balance. Standardization usually helps with consistency, but it can also mean more formal procedures when something goes wrong.
How to get better results when contacting support
You do not need to be an expert to get a useful answer. You just need to ask clean, specific questions. The more precise your message, the less likely you are to receive a generic reply. Use this approach:
- State the issue in one sentence.
- Include the device you used, if the issue was technical.
- Mention the transaction type if the issue is payment-related.
- Attach only the necessary documents if verification is requested.
- Keep your account details consistent with your registration information.
For example, instead of saying “my withdrawal is broken,” say “my CAD withdrawal has been pending since I submitted it, and I want to know whether any documents are missing.” That gives support a clean starting point. It also reduces back-and-forth. Beginners often think being vague will make a problem sound less serious. In practice, specificity makes the process faster.
If the issue concerns rules rather than a technical fault, ask the casino to point you to the exact policy section. That is especially useful for bonus conditions and self-service account tools. Support should be able to explain the rule in plain language, even if the rule itself is non-negotiable.
